Responsibilities

What’s a typical day as a Patient Support Specialist? You’ll be:
• Serving as the point person for a select number of patients/caregivers in supporting their treatment through an online case management system
• Responding to inquiries from patients/caregivers/sites regarding the patient support service offerings using a call guide resource
• Performing administrative functions of requesting and responding to travel and logistics, sometimes urgently since last minutes change is highly probable while staying calm and offering support to the patient/caregiver
• Validating patient travel expenditures in compliance with SOPs and provide reimbursement through third-party supplier partner
• Entering and maintain accurate data and records into the patient management tool in compliance with the program requirements
• Following all SOPs to ensure program compliance in working with patients and capturing data requirements needed for the program
• Capturing all required elements for enrolled patients to process reimbursement and ensure compliance with the program requirements
• Proactively working with patients/caregivers showing empathy and compassion throughout their treatment plan
• Working to monitor performance and help find operational improvements in the end-to-end patient experience so that we can continue to improve our service offerings over time in support patients
• Performing other duties as assigned
